Interventional Radiology - Foraminal Infiltration

 Foraminal infiltration consists of a minimally invasive method for the treatment of the spinal pain and which may allow a rapid improvement of the painful process.

Those blockagess consist of the injection of medications (corticosteroids and local anesthetics) in some places of the spine, in order to block the painful stimulus originated in the orifices where the nerves that go to the limbs pass.

 

PRECAUTIONS TO BE TAKEN

  • The patient should fast 3 hours prior to the exam.

  • You should buy and bring 1 vial of Depo-Medrol 80 mg.
